热文MySQL数据库连接问题:十种排查方法
在连接MySQL数据库时,可能会遇到各种问题。这里为你提供十种排查和解决MySQL数据库连接问题的方法: 1. **检查服务器状态**: 确保你的MySQL服务器正在运
在连接MySQL数据库时,可能会遇到各种问题。这里为你提供十种排查和解决MySQL数据库连接问题的方法: 1. **检查服务器状态**: 确保你的MySQL服务器正在运
在 MySQL 中,如果尝试更新表结构但失败,通常有以下几个原因,以及相应的解决步骤: 1. 权限不足: 如果你的用户账户没有足够的权限来修改表结构(比如 `ALTER
SQL注入是一种常见的网络安全威胁,它通过在用户输入的数据中插入恶意的SQL代码,从而达到窃取、修改数据库信息的目的。 对于无症状的SQL注入问题,一般有以下几种情况: 1
MySQL备份和恢复是数据库管理的重要部分。在操作过程中,可能会遇到一些常见的错误,下面是一些错误及其应对策略: 1. **备份失败**:可能是磁盘空间不足,或者权限设置不正
在MySQL中,当并发控制不足时,可能会出现以下几种导致数据不一致的问题: 1. **事务隔离级别不够**: - MySQL默认的隔离级别是`READ UNCOMMIT
在MySQL升级过程中,可能会遇到各种问题。以下是一些常见问题及其解决方案的案例: 1. **版本不兼容**:新版本可能对老数据结构或特性有所改变,导致升级后无法正常工作。
在MySQL中,正确的权限管理是保证数据安全和防止未经授权操作的关键。以下是如何正确分配角色和权限的步骤: 1. **创建角色(Role)**: - `GRANT` 语
在MySQL中,频繁的表结构修改确实会降低系统效率。以下是一些高效维护表结构的方法: 1. 分批更新: 如果一次修改太多列或数据过多,可以分成多个小批次进行。 2.
在使用MySQL进行数据库交互时,如果出现连接超时的问题,通常意味着以下情况: 1. **网络问题**:可能由于网络连接不稳定或速度慢导致连接超时。 2. **服务器负载过
在MySQL数据库备份和恢复过程中,如果出现失败的情况,我们可以按照以下步骤进行问题检测和修复: 1. **问题识别**: - 检查日志:如MySQL的错误日志 (`m
在MySQL中,如果一个表中的某个索引失效,可能会导致查询性能下降。以下是索引失效的一些可能原因以及解决方案: 1. 索引重建或删除: - **解决方案**:通过`RE
在MySQL中,如果事务处理失败,可能由于多种原因。这里列举一些常见的问题及解决方案: 1. 事务中有插入数据但未提交: - 解决方案:确保在执行任何更新操作后都使用`
在MySQL数据库中,由于新手的误操作,数据丢失的情况经常发生。以下是一个常见的案例: 1. **删除表**: 在学习如何创建和管理数据库时,新手可能会误将一个重要的数
MySQL性能瓶颈的识别通常涉及到监控系统、分析查询日志和使用性能测试工具等多种方法。 以下是一些具体问题实例及解决步骤: 1. **频繁全表扫描**:例如,执行`SELE
MySQL是广泛应用的开源数据库管理系统。它可能会遇到一些稳定性问题,以下是一些故障示例和对应的恢复策略: 1. **服务中断**: - 故障示例:网络故障导致MySQ
MySQL集群部署在实际操作中可能会遇到一些常见问题,下面给出一些问题及其解决方案: 1. **数据一致性问题**: - 解决方案:可以使用MySQL的`InnoDB`
在高并发场景下,MySQL出现崩溃的原因可能包括以下几点: 1. 资源耗尽:当大量并发请求同时写入数据库时,可能会导致内存不足、磁盘空间紧张等问题。 2. 查询优化失败:并
在MySQL数据库中,安全性问题是常见的。以下是一些常见的现象以及相应的预防措施: 1. 密码泄露:如果数据库管理员的密码被获取,可能对整个系统构成威胁。预防措施包括定期更改
在MySQL中,如果表空间(通常指InnoDB存储引擎的数据区域)使用异常,可能会导致数据库性能下降或者数据丢失。以下是一些排查和处理的方法: 1. **检查空间使用情况**
MySQL定时任务执行异常可能由多种原因导致,以下是一些常见的问题及解决方案: 1. **权限问题**:任务执行需要特定的权限,如`SELECT`、`INSERT`等。检查权
在使用MySQL进行备份恢复时,可能会遇到一些问题导致操作失败。以下是一些常见原因及对应的解决策略: 1. **权限问题**: - 如果用户无权访问数据库或执行特定的S
在Linux环境下解决MySQL连接问题通常涉及以下几个步骤: 1. **检查MySQL服务状态**:使用`systemctl status mysql`(对于基于Syste
MySQL查询性能低下可能由多种因素导致,以下是一些常见的解决方案: 1. **优化SQL**:确保你的查询是明确的、高效的。避免使用全表扫描(`SELECT * FROM
在MySQL升级过程中,可能会遇到以下几种问题: 1. **版本不兼容**:升级前没有检查新版本和现有版本的兼容性。解决方法是确保新版本支持你现有的数据结构。 2. **权
MySQL存储过程是数据库操作的一种高级方式,它可以在执行时进行参数传递和复杂逻辑控制。然而,如何优化存储过程以提高性能呢?以下是一些示例对比和改进策略: 1. **减少SQ
当MySQL服务器负载过高时,通常会出现以下一些症状: 1. **查询速度下降**:用户请求数据的速度明显减慢。 2. **响应时间延长**:用户等待系统处理完请求的时间增
当使用MySQL连接池时,出现“溢出”问题通常意味着连接数达到了预设的最大值。以下是详细的故障重现以及解决方案: 1. 故障重现: - 在应用程序中配置了一个较大的连接
在MySQL中,事务处理是一种管理数据库操作的方式。如果事务中的一个或多个SQL命令执行失败,将会导致整个事务回滚。以下是MySQL事务处理失败的一些常见错误及预防措施: 1
在MySQL中,合理的索引设计可以显著提高查询效率。如果索引设计不当,可能会导致以下问题,影响性能: 1. **冗余索引**: 如果一个列已经被其他索引覆盖,那么这个列
MySQL定时任务未触发,可能是由多种原因引起的。以下是一些常见的问题和解决思路: 1. **任务设置不正确**: - 检查SQL脚本是否有效,没有语法错误。 -
在使用MySQL创建表时,可能会遇到各种问题。以下是一些常见的问题及其解决办法: 1. 错误信息未提供: - 解决方法:请提供具体的错误信息,这样我们才能判断问题所在并
在MySQL更新数据时出现乱码问题,这通常涉及到字符编码不匹配的问题。以下是问题排查及修复策略: 1. **检查数据库设置**: - 确保你的MySQL服务器使用的是正
MySQL是广泛应用的关系型数据库管理系统,其缓存机制主要依赖于InnoDB存储引擎的Buffer Pool。然而,在处理大量读写操作或复杂查询时,MySQL的缓存机制可能存在
MySQL安全防护常见漏洞主要包括以下几类,每种都有具体的案例和防范策略: 1. SQL注入: 案例:用户在提交表单时,允许输入特定的字段。若字段未进行任何验证,恶意用
在使用MySQL的扩展功能,如存储过程和函数,可能会遇到一些常见问题。以下是一些解答和困惑的解决方案: 1. **编写和理解存储过程**: - 存储过程是可重用的SQL